New Jersey's Gambling Industry: A Look at the Past, Present, and Future

In January 2024, New Jersey's casino industry experienced a significant surge in its earnings, marking another success in the state's long history with legalized gambling. Since the authorization of casino gambling in Atlantic City in 1976, New Jersey has been at the forefront of the gambling and betting industry in the United States, aiming to rejuvenate the city's economy and secure its status as a prime destination for gamblers on the East Coast. This effort has undoubtedly paved the way for the industry's expansive growth in the state.

Adaptation and Expansion of Betting Laws

The evolution of New Jersey's betting laws over the years has significantly broadened the scope of legal gambling within the state. Since the historic legislation in 1976, Atlantic City has flourished into a hub for traditional casino gambling. Beyond the classic casino offerings, New Jersey has embraced a progressive stance towards betting, legalizing sports betting, both online and in-person, alongside horse racing betting. The state also supports a lottery with a variety of games available to the public, while charitable gambling activities such as bingo and raffles are permitted. Furthermore, the regulation and legalization of online poker have contributed to a diversified gambling landscape in New Jersey.

Revenue Trends in New Jersey's Gambling Industry

The start of 2024 has seen New Jersey's casino hotels generate $205 million in revenue during January alone, marking a slight decrease from January 2023's $211 million. Despite this minor fluctuation, online gaming has seen an impressive revenue of $183.3 million in the same period, with sports betting contributing an additional $170 million to the state's coffers. Cumulatively, New Jersey's total gambling revenue in January 2024 reached a remarkable $559 million, showcasing the dynamic and growing appeal of the gambling industry within the state.

Technological Innovations and Online Betting's Rise

The ascendency of online gambling applications and websites has played a pivotal role in expanding the reach of New Jersey's betting industry. Mobile platforms have dismantled geographical and physical barriers, enabling enthusiasts to engage in betting activities from virtually anywhere. The introduction of sports betting has broadened the industry's appeal, attracting a new demographic of patrons to the gambling scene. Moreover, the application of emerging technologies such as aug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) in gaming has captivated a more tech-savvy audience, further enhancing the state's gambling allure.
